The Grand Elder looked at the other elders and a smile spread across his stern face. "From now on, the Zhou Family is on high alert. Recall all our clansmen above the Saint Tier who are currently outside. Be ready at all times to face an attack from the Anti-Zhou Alliance!"
"It's also time to tell the clansmen about this. In a way, this attack isn't entirely a bad thing. For years, the Zhou Family has held a dominant position, and our clansmen have lacked combat experience and fighting spirit."
"I propose we establish a kill list. Killing a certain number of cultivators from the Anti-Zhou Alliance will earn certain rewards. This will help motivate our clansmen. These details need to be planned carefully."
"I agree."
"Seconded."
Following this, the many elders of the Zhou Family discussed the kill list and strategies for dealing with the Anti-Zhou Alliance.
Zhou Family Pill Pavilion.
Zhou Qiongtian was looking at a comprehensive guide to formation basics. This kind of cultivation technique was common, something you could find in any Spirit Treasure Pavilion, and it wasn't expensive.
This was the most basic cultivation technique for Formation Dao cultivators. Almost every cultivator of the Formation Dao had a copy. Although Zhou Qiongtian's mastery of the Formation Dao had reached the Quasi-Supreme Grandmaster level, he had never actually studied it.
However, precisely because his mastery of the Formation Dao had reached the Quasi-Supreme Grandmaster level, this comprehensive guide to formation basics was as simple as one plus one equals two in his eyes.
Not only that, but he could also use it to extrapolate other formations. Various thoughts and ideas constantly arose and collided, and the structures and mysteries of countless formations were continuously generated in his mind.
Knowledge about formations kept accumulating in Zhou Qiongtian's mind. He finished reading the entire comprehensive guide, which contained millions of words and countless formation diagrams, in less than half an hour, and he understood it completely.
Zhou Qiongtian casually drew formation patterns in the air, and an Earth-grade confinement formation was successfully set up by him.
Zhou Qiongtian stroked his chin, looking with great interest at this Earth-grade confinement formation. Formation patterns appeared before his eyes, and then countless thoughts popped into his mind.
For example, changing these few formation patterns would consume much less spiritual energy. Changing these few formation patterns would increase the power of the confinement formation by thirty percent...
Then, Zhou Qiongtian got to work. Formation patterns were removed, modified, and added. In a moment, another confinement formation took shape, its power increased severalfold.
If the previous confinement formation could trap cultivators in the Cycle Early Stage, then the current one would take even a cultivator in the Cycle Great Perfection a long time to break.
And this was just Zhou Qiongtian setting it up casually.
Zhou Qiongtian continued to browse through other Formation Dao cultivation techniques, from Mortal-grade to Saint Tier. He didn't look at many, only a few hundred.
Once you understand one, you understand them all. With his Quasi-Supreme Grandmaster mastery of the Formation Dao, he could extend his understanding from one formation to another, generalizing from one instance to all.
Speaking of which, the Zhou Family did not have any experts at the Quasi-Supreme Grandmaster level in the Formation Dao. Zhou Qiongtian was already the strongest in the Zhou Family in terms of Formation Dao attainment.
Zhou Qiongtian spent three days in the Pill Pavilion, and his understanding of the Formation Dao reached a new level. Before, he had the mastery but hadn't studied the relevant formations.
Although he could still set up formations through his powerful mastery, it required some effort.
Now, Zhou Qiongtian could easily set up Saint Tier grand formations. Even those at the Saint King level were handled with ease. If not for his insufficient cultivation, he could even set up Venerable Tier grand formations.
Zhou Qiongtian then looked at two Venerable Tier Formation Dao cultivation techniques. Even the Zhou Family only collected two, but each contained quite a few Venerable Tier grand formations.
When Zhou Qiongtian's cultivation reaches the Saint King level, he would be able to set up Venerable Tier grand formations. At that time, he could contend against Supreme Beings with the help of these formations!
Afterward, Zhou Qiongtian went to find Soul Dao cultivation techniques. His mastery of the Soul Dao had also reached the Quasi-Supreme Grandmaster level, making him the number one in the Zhou Family for Soul Dao as well.
Soul Dao involved the Divine Soul. The most common Soul Dao divine ability in the Azure World was soul searching, which basically every cultivator knew about.
Compared to the Formation Dao, Sword Dao, and Strength Dao, there were far fewer cultivators who specialized in the Soul Dao. This also resulted in far fewer Soul Dao cultivation techniques compared to other Daos.
As the overlord of the Azure World, the Zhou Family had countless cultivation techniques in its Pill Pavilion, but there were still not many Soul Dao techniques, and the number of cultivators specializing in Soul Dao was also small.
After browsing through some Soul Dao cultivation techniques, Zhou Qiongtian looked for the highest-grade Soul Dao cultivation technique in the Zhou Family. He was now a Quasi-Supreme Grandmaster of the Soul Dao, so he could learn most Soul Dao cultivation techniques almost instantly.
The highest-grade cultivation technique in the Zhou Family's Pill Pavilion was a top-tier existence at the Saint King level: the Soul Splitting Technique!
The Soul Splitting Technique could split the user's Divine Soul. The split Divine Soul would only be half the size of the original. After splitting, the Divine Soul would quickly heal, thus strengthening the Soul Dao foundation.
Divine Souls were divided into Ten-person Soul, Hundred-person Soul, Thousand-person Soul, Ten-thousand-person Soul, and so on, based on their strength.
Generally, cultivators in the Spirit Channeling Realm could reach the Ten-person Soul level after a qualitative change in their Divine Soul.
After the Spirit Channeling Realm, the Divine Soul would grow to a certain extent with each breakthrough of a major realm. For cultivators who did not practice the Soul Dao, it would require Feather Ascension Realm cultivation to reach the Hundred-person Soul.
The Saint Tier, transcending the mundane and becoming a Saint, would cause a qualitative change in the Divine Soul, transforming it into a Thousand-person Soul.
Zhou Qiongtian was in the early Saint stage, but his Divine Soul's strength far surpassed that of other Saints, reaching the Ten-thousand-person Soul level.
Zhou Qiongtian had not deliberately cultivated his Divine Soul, but his Quasi-Supreme Grandmaster mastery of the Soul Dao had brought his Divine Soul foundation to the Ten-thousand-person Soul level.
Zhou Qiongtian's current Divine Soul was like a cup. Even if there were vast rivers outside, the container was only this size and could only hold a cup of water, making it difficult to unleash the full power of the Soul Dao.
Zhou Qiongtian took a deep breath, adjusted his state to its peak, and then began to perform the Soul Splitting Technique.
Pain! Unparalleled pain!
It felt as if someone was tearing him apart forcefully, and it was a slow tearing. Zhou Qiongtian could clearly feel his Divine Soul being torn apart. He could stop it immediately, but he wouldn't.
If he did, this soul splitting would fail. Not only would the benefits be almost zero, but his Divine Soul would also be injured.
The pain of tearing the Divine Soul far surpassed the pain of tearing the physical body. During the soul splitting process, Zhou Qiongtian's body trembled uncontrollably, his face turned pale, and he gritted his teeth, trying not to make a sound, but soon he let out painful low growls and moans.
It took a full half an hour. This time, which Zhou Qiongtian usually felt was short, felt exceptionally long at this moment.
Zhou Qiongtian was covered in cold sweat, as if he had just been fished out of water.
Zhou Qiongtian felt his consciousness sea. His Divine Soul had split into two, becoming half its previous size. The two Divine Souls healed at an extremely fast speed. After half an hour, the two Divine Souls returned to their original size before splitting.
Then, the two Divine Souls merged into one, becoming a more powerful Divine Soul.
